Prestbury is a traditional, quaint English village nestled in Gloucestershire, south-west England. It’s famed for its stunning scenery and rich history.

What makes Prestbury a good place to live

Living in Prestbury offers a serene, community-focused lifestyle ideally suited to families and working professionals. Its charm lies in its picturesque streets and historical architecture, the closeness to Cheltenham town, and a well-regarded primary school. Prestbury has a range of local amenities, including shops, pubs, and social events.

What makes Prestbury a bad place to live

One downside of Prestbury is the limited night-life and entertainment avenues, which might displease students or younger adults seeking a bustling nightlife. Also, property prices can be higher than average due to the highly desirable location.

Buying and renting in Prestbury

The average house price in Prestbury hovers around £400,000 while rental costs average at £1000 per month, leaning towards the higher end due to the desirable and attractive location.

Public transportation in Prestbury

Prestbury is served by several bus routes connecting it to Cheltenham and the surrounding towns. The nearest train station is in Cheltenham. Airports nearby include Gloucestershire and Birmingham Airport, both accessible by car or public transport.

Safety in Prestbury

Prestbury enjoys a lower-than-average crime rate, making it a safe place to live. However, like any location, vigilance is advisable, especially during nighttime.

Most popular areas in Prestbury

The Burgage (GL52 3DL)

This is a desirable area due to its close proximity to local shops, pubs and the village centre.

Mill Street (GL52 3BG)

Mill Street is popular for its tranquillity, close-knit community feel, and stunning properties.

Least popular areas in Prestbury

Overbury Road (GL52 5AR)

Although a peaceful locale, it’s somewhat distant from the village amenities.

New Barn Lane (GL52 3LF)

This area is less popular due to its proximity to the racecourse, which can cause occasional disruptions due to events.
